首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何获取WordPress while循环posts到引导网格?

WordPress是一种流行的内容管理系统(CMS),它提供了一个强大的平台来创建和管理网站。在WordPress中,可以使用while循环来获取并显示文章。

在获取WordPress文章时,可以使用以下代码:

代码语言:txt
复制
<?php
$args = array(
    'post_type' => 'post', // 文章类型
    'posts_per_page' => -1, // 显示所有文章
);

$loop = new WP_Query($args);

if ($loop->have_posts()) {
    while ($loop->have_posts()) {
        $loop->the_post();
        // 在这里编写你想要显示的文章内容
        the_title(); // 显示文章标题
        the_content(); // 显示文章内容
    }
}

wp_reset_postdata(); // 重置文章数据
?>

上述代码中,首先定义了一个$args数组,用于指定获取文章的条件。'post_type'参数指定了文章类型为'post','posts_per_page'参数设置为-1表示获取所有文章。

接下来,使用WP_Query类创建了一个$loop对象,并传入$args数组作为参数。然后,使用while循环遍历$loop对象中的文章,使用the_title()和the_content()函数来显示文章的标题和内容。

最后,使用wp_reset_postdata()函数重置文章数据,以确保不会影响到后续的查询。

这种方法可以用于在WordPress中获取并显示文章。根据具体需求,可以根据文章类型、分类、标签等条件进行筛选。同时,可以根据需要在循环中添加其他的代码来实现更多的功能。

腾讯云提供了云服务器(CVM)和云数据库(CDB)等产品,可以作为WordPress的托管平台。您可以通过以下链接了解更多关于腾讯云的产品信息:

请注意,以上链接仅供参考,具体选择适合您需求的产品和服务,请根据实际情况进行判断和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 使用 PostMeta 提速 WordPress 插件

    WordPress Related Posts 这个插件已经被下载了2万多次。但是个人对这个插件一直有一个不满意的地方,那就是效率不是很高。我在我的 Bluehost 空间安装这个插件的时候,几次因为这个插件 SLOW SQL 搞的 CPU 超限而被 Suspend 了几分钟,狂晕。 是的,这个插件是使用了一条效率很低的 SQL,因为根据 Tag 来查找相关日至要对所有的 Post 扫一便,看看是不是有相同的 Tag。我想了很久,还是没有想到效率更高的缓存,大学的时候 SQL 还是学得不错,但是现在基本都不懂了,汗!既然没有想到效率更高的 SQL,我想到的第二个方法是缓存,第一个方法是可以使用 WordPress 对象缓存,但是 WordPress 2.5 已经全部采用内存缓存而舍弃了文件缓存,如果主机没有安装内存缓存模块,基本没用,当然也可以是用高级缓存插件,如:WordPress Super Cache。不过我这里使用的是 PostMeta 来缓存。

    02
    领券